Rams Ready to Make a Splash in 2025: What Fans Can Expect

2025 NFL season Rams expectations with player and coach celebrating.

Rams Set for a Strong Comeback in 2025

Los Angeles Rams' head coach Sean McVay is about to embark on another exciting season, and this time he might just make the headlines he strives for. With an impressive roster, a clear vision, and the drive that propelled him to a Super Bowl victory, the Rams are eyeing another shot at NFL glory in 2025.

A Strategic Rebuild Under McVay

McVay's journey since the Rams' 2021 Super Bowl win showcases his dedication to the game. After contemplating a lucrative TV career, he opted for the challenging route of rebuilding a team that had faced adversity. His efforts are starting to pay off, bolstering the Rams' lineup and restoring the confidence needed to excel in the coming season.

Dynamic Offense: A Mix of Youth and Experience

At the core of the Rams' offense is veteran quarterback Matthew Stafford, still performing at an elite level at 37 years old. The addition of seasoned player Davante Adams, alongside rising star Puka Nacua, completes a strong receiving tandem reminiscent of the triumphant days of Cooper Kupp and Odell Beckham Jr. Moreover, the tight end position has never looked so promising for McVay, with Tyler Higbee's recovery and promising rookies, such as Terrance Ferguson, adding depth and skill to the roster.

Strengthening the Offensive Line

Every successful play starts at the line of scrimmage. The Rams' offensive line, which faced challenges last season, is showing signs of stability and improvement. With returning players and offseason additions like Coleman Shelton, who knows the Rams' system well, the team is poised for a strong performance. However, questions remain about depth, especially behind tackles Alaric Jackson and Rob Havenstein.

Bolt of Energy on Defense: Jared Verse

The Rams' defense is not to be overlooked. Jared Verse, a powerful presence on the defensive line, has proven his strength by dominating larger opponents on the field. His capabilities make him an exciting player to watch and a crucial part of the Rams' strategy against tough NFC rivals.

Looking Ahead: Championship Aspirations

As the countdown to the 2025 NFL season begins, the Rams are primed not only for playoff contention but also for a potential return to the Super Bowl. With their sights set on the championship, the blend of experience and youthful energy creates an optimistic outlook for the franchise.

The Rams' resurgence embodies hope and ambition, a narrative that resonates with both die-hard fans and casual observers. There’s a sense that this team is on the brink of something big, and as the competition heats up, all eyes will be on Los Angeles.

Discover How You Can Support Biodiversity in Rose Creek

Update Celebrating Biodiversity: Rose Creek's Vital Role On a recent Saturday morning marked by clouds and community spirit, the Friends of Rose Creek hosted a vibrant California Biodiversity Day BioBlitz. Participants gathered in Pacific Beach to document the rich array of flora and fauna found in this unique ecosystem, engaging with nature's wonders while contributing valuable data to science. Karin Zirk, executive director of Friends of Rose Creek, remarked on how their organization has focused on optimizing the ‘orphan’ stretch of Rose Creek, which extends from Marion Bear Park to Mission Bay Park. The aim is not only to foster a healthy environment but also to raise awareness of how local ecosystems directly connect to the broader health of San Diego’s water systems. “Everything that exists in Rose Creek eventually impacts Mission Bay,” Zirk emphasized, underlining the interconnectedness of these natural habitats. Community and Conservation: A Partnership The BioBlitz attracted participants from various locales within San Diego County, showcasing the community's commitment to conservation. Volunteer efforts can range significantly, from a handful of dedicated individuals to over 100 enthusiastic participants, all contributing to the vital task of cleaning up and documenting the region's natural environment. Each photograph taken during the event provides crucial data that scientists utilize to track environmental changes over time. As Zirk pointed out, San Diego County epitomizes biodiversity, boasting multiple microclimates and unique ecosystems that host a wealth of plant and animal life. The knowledge shared through events like the BioBlitz places a spotlight on the need for preserving these natural treasures, which are increasingly under threat. Utilizing Technology for Biodiversity Assessment A key component of the BioBlitz was the use of the iNaturalist app. By capturing and documenting images of local species, participants contributed to a global database valuable for researchers monitoring climate change effects on wildlife. This approach fosters an important dialogue about how even small local actions can contribute to global understanding and preservation efforts. “With salt marshes being among the most endangered habitats in California, our documentation efforts take on increased importance,” Zirk stated. The images contribute to the collective understanding of environmental shifts and the health of ecosystems, as restoration plans for areas like the salt marsh are in the works. The Bigger Picture: Global Goals Start Locally California Biodiversity Day celebrates collective action toward environmental stewardship. While the week of Sept. 6-14 was central to the BioBlitz, the call for action continues year-round. Educating the public about local biodiversity, engaging volunteers, and utilizing technology for tracking species are just a few ways communities can collectively participate in conserving nature. While Zirk and her team focus on the Rose Creek area today, the principles of community engagement and biodiversity awareness resonate in ecosystems globally. Initiatives like these remind us that local action can echo in the quest for global sustainability. Taking Action: Join the Movement Being part of a community that values and protects its natural environment is crucial. Whether through volunteering, participating in similar events, or simply educating oneself about local ecosystems, you can help make a difference. The Friends of Rose Creek invite individuals of all ages to explore ways to engage with nature and contribute to the ongoing efforts to protect these vital habitats.

The Wild Side of Feeding Birds: Unexpected Wildlife Invasion

Update Attracting Nature: The Journey to Hummingbird ParadiseAttempting to attract hummingbirds can seem like a delightful endeavor, but what happens when this quest for feathered friends invites a whole host of uninvited wildlife? This humorous tale of one homeowner's experience offers a glimpse into how well-intentioned acts can spiral into unexpected challenges. The Sweet Allure of Hummingbird FeedersAfter investing in 25 pounds of sugar and a dozen hummingbird feeders, the dream of hosting these vibrant creatures on the patio was alive. The extra sugar-water mixture promised visits from hummingbirds with their iridescent plumage and rapid wing beats. However, the sweet scent soon attracted more than just the intended guests.Uninvited Guests and the Battle for the FeedersInitially, it started with some local birds, but before long, the seed feeders populating the patio became a buffet for hungry mice. The introduction of humane traps didn't help, leading to a daily chore of relocating the little nuisances. And while a diverse flock of birds was welcome, the appearance of bees at the nectar feeders transformed the once-bustling feeding station into a scene of chaos. With swarms of bees consuming the feeders, the bright hummingbirds were left in the dust.The Unexpected Costs of Attracting WildlifeIt’s worth examining the financial and emotional investment of creating a home for these creatures. Not only did it involve purchasing sugar and multiple feeders, but it also required an investment of time, from trapping mice to managing an ecosystem that was quickly out of control. As the number of unwanted guests escalated, so did the tension. With wildlife turning into a full-time job, the perks of watching feathered friends dwindled.Finding Peace on the PatioUltimately, the decision to remove all feeders brought serenity back to the space, illustrating that sometimes less truly is more. By forgoing the traditional feeding approach, the environment became not just a place for birds but a relaxing retreat for the homeowners. Experiencing the patio free of wildlife let the couple reconnect in their little sanctuary, reinforcing the idea that balance between nature and personal space is essential.Lessons Learned from Nature’s PlaygroundThis whimsical journey brings to light the hidden challenges that arise from feeding wildlife. While the desire to create an inviting atmosphere for nature is noble, the side effects can lead to a myriad of problems, including pest control, financial costs, and unexpected wildlife dynamics. As many pet owners and gardeners can attest, the quest for harmony between humans and the wild often requires a strategic approach.The exuberance of feeding hummingbirds and other birds can quickly become an unpredictable circus of competing wildlife if we aren’t careful. From the joys of connection with nature to the perils of mouse invasions and bee swarms, this humorous account serves as a reminder to cherish nature from a distance, ensuring that we maintain a healthy balance.

Margaritaville Hotel Honors Jimmy Buffett Day Through Fundraising Events

Update Celebrating a Music Legend: Margaritaville Hotel's Tribute The Margaritaville Hotel in San Diego's Gaslamp Quarter recently transformed into a vibrant celebration of music and philanthropy, marking the unofficial holiday known as Jimmy Buffett Day. This lively weekend event encapsulated the spirit of the late singer-songwriter while raising funds for the San Diego Music Foundation, an organization tasked with enhancing musical education and outreach within the community. A Festive Community Gathering Parrotheads from all walks of life gathered at the hotel to enjoy a variety of tropical cocktails and revel in performances from local artists. A key highlight of the event was a travel-themed silent auction, drawing bids on prizes that inspired wanderlust, and further engaging the crowd in fun and charitable endeavors. In a commitment to community service, the City of San Diego issued an official proclamation recognizing the Friday before Labor Day as the Margaritaville San Diego Day of Service, echoing Buffett’s timeless motto of serving others. The Impact of Music on Community Beyond the festivities, the event spotlighted how music acts as a unifying force in society. The San Diego Music Foundation leverages contributions to support local music programming and education initiatives aimed at youth. Observing the enthusiastic participation from community members, it’s evident that events like these are not only about celebrating a beloved artist but also about galvanizing support for future generations of musicians. Engaging with a Cause The attendance was a testament to the vibrant community spirit in San Diego, highlighting an inherent appreciation for live music and collaboration. As guests enjoyed the weekend’s array of offerings, they also engaged in discussions about the relevance of supporting local arts. This gathering offered insight into how local businesses, like Margaritaville Hotel, can play pivotal roles in fostering community connections. Looking Ahead: More Events to Inspire As the success of this event illustrates, the intersection of music and philanthropy has profound implications for community engagement. There are plans for future events that aim to continue fundraising efforts with local artists, providing platforms for music appreciation while supporting essential causes. Keeping the legacy of artists like Jimmy Buffett alive not only honors their work but also creates opportunities for others to thrive. The Margaritaville Hotel's commitment to this vision showcases the potential of businesses in leading community outreach through the arts. This event serves as a reminder that music is not just a form of entertainment but a powerful vehicle for change in society.
